Be careful not to price yourself out of the market when you set the rent for your furnished apartment. You may be unable to lease the apartment to anyone, if you set the rent too high. You may be better off to sell or keep them and let the flat unfurnished, if you are concerned about your furnishings. Generally speaking, the rent should be establish by you based on your own expenses to possess and keep the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return in your investment. For example, to make $5,000 per year on the property, the yearly rent you desire if it costs you $15,000 per year to own and maintain the property, and should be $20,000, or about $1,675 per month. Compare that cost to other rents in the area, taking into account the features and furnishings of your property, and charge rent that'll meet your needs yet still be competitive.

When letting a furnished flat to protect your investment, it is wise to provide the tenant with an itemized list of the items comprised in the apartment lease. Be quite special; list the amount of plates, bowls, and cups, for instance, and describe things as correctly as possible. List the replacement cost of each item if it's damaged beyond normal wear and tear, or if the renter takes the piece with him when he moves out. Signal if the renter will have to pay you directly for the items, or if the replacement cost will be required out of the security deposit. Have the tenant sign a copy of this stock so there are no surprises when the lease comes to a conclusion.

If you rent a home or apartment that is furnished, whether it is fully furnished with furniture, linens, electronic equipment, and accessories or contains only some basic furniture, you can charge tenants higher rent. You had to purchase the items which are furnishing the house, and will have to replace those things if they may be damaged or ruined. Those costs will be recouped by a monthly rent that is higher. It really is up to you as the landlord to determine how much more you need to bill for the furnishings, but commonly owners will base the increased price on the condition and style of the furnishings. For instance, a property that includes a brand new, modern living room set is worth more than one that includes mismatched pieces with frayed seams.
In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ished apartment, you could ask for a higher security deposit on the lease. Collecting more money up front can help you cover the costs of replacing or repairing the things in the furnished apartment if they're damaged. Before collecting the security deposit, however check with your state laws. Some states have laws regulating what landlords can charge and security deposits. You could also charge a separate cleaning fee for the rental, to pay for the costs of cleaning furniture, bedding, drapes and other things, should you not want to include it in the security deposit.

The dates and times of departure and arrival are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ned between stays. To prevent vacancy between stays, the time between check-in and checkout is typically a relatively brief window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are sometimes last minute requests to arrive or depart early or late. It's, thus, vital that you include eventuality requests in the lease, signifying both a cost and a procedure to alter agreed-upon strategies.
